Output 955d8796355b6ba3af71490aa1b8e604ed87a457f85c4fb7d227874ce9b27bfb:0

value
10315500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6ea2ffd98caaefb3268d99ed118577ef542bda OP_EQUAL
address
3JxeAyRCd3hPJCnDtw7ZwpmiZSpiMpHdUb
transaction
955d8796355b6ba3af71490aa1b8e604ed87a457f85c4fb7d227874ce9b27bfb
spent
true